Secondly, the process is going to be ridiculously costly if ... WebbThe process of loss of water from the surfaces of leaves through evaporation is called transpiration. Water evaporates from tiny pores on the surfaces of leaves called stomata. Stomata are tiny pores in the epidermis of leaves, which is the outermost layer of cells.

Webb5 apr. 2024 · Groundwater evaporation represents groundwater loss by direct evaporation from water table. This process takes place in bare soil environments and it is the most distinct in dry lands with shallow water table and coarse unsaturated zone material. WebbMulti-stage flash distillation (MSF) The water to be desalinated is heated at low pressure, which causes sudden, irreversible evaporation. This process is repeated in successive stages where the pressure decreases according to different conditions. Within the plant … northland industrial buildingWebb6 dec. 2024 · Water vapor also enters the water cycle through transpiration. This is the process of water moving through plants and being released from plant leaves as vapor into the atmosphere. Transpiration accounts for about 10 percent of the water vapor in the atmosphere.
